Bowdlerization : (noun) 1: written material that has been bowdlerized [syn: bowdlerisation]
2: the act of deleting or modifying all passages considered to
be indecent [syn: bowdlerisation]

Bowdlerize \Bowd"ler*ize\, v. t. [imp. & p. p. Bowdlerized; p.
pr. & vb. n. Bowdlerizing.] [After Dr. Thomas Bowdler, an
English physician, who published an expurgated edition of
Shakespeare in 1818.]
To expurgate, as a book, by omitting or modifying the parts
considered offensive.
It is a grave defect in the splendid tale of Tom Jones
. . . that a Bowlderized version of it would be hardly
intelligible as a tale. --F. Harrison.
-- Bowd`ler*i*za"tion, n. -- Bowd"ler*ism, n.
